Hernandia moerenhoutiana subsp. campanulata is a tree belonging to the Hernandiaceae family. Indigenous to the Pacific, this subspecies is primarily associated with wet tropical conditions. It is a naturally occurring subspecies of Hernandia moerenhoutiana, which is linked below, along with other subspecies of this species.

Native Range
Continents (WGSRPD)
PACIFIC
Regions (WGSRPD)
South-Central Pacific, Southwestern Pacific
Botanical Countries (WGSRPD L3)
Fiji, Niue, Samoa, Society Is., Tonga, Wallis-Futuna Is.
